在mysql中,產(chǎn)品類別表是非常常見的一種表結(jié)構(gòu)。它主要用于存儲不同產(chǎn)品的分類信息,方便在頁面中呈現(xiàn)不同的產(chǎn)品分類。
下面就是一個(gè)簡單的mysql產(chǎn)品類別表設(shè)計(jì):
CREATE TABLE `product_category` ( `id` int(11) NOT NULL AUTO_INCREMENT COMMENT '分類id', `name` varchar(64) COLLATE utf8mb4_unicode_ci NOT NULL COMMENT '分類名稱', `parent_id` int(11) NOT NULL DEFAULT '0' COMMENT '父級分類id', `sort_order` int(4) NOT NULL DEFAULT '10' COMMENT '排序', `is_show` tinyint(1) NOT NULL DEFAULT '1' COMMENT '是否顯示', PRIMARY KEY (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_unicode_ci COMMENT='產(chǎn)品分類';
該表包含了以下字段:
- id:該分類的唯一標(biāo)識。
- name:該分類的名稱,可以用于在頁面中呈現(xiàn)分類名稱。
- parent_id:該分類的父級分類id,用于構(gòu)建分類的樹形結(jié)構(gòu)。
- sort_order:該分類在父級分類下的排序。
- is_show:該分類是否在頁面中顯示。
通過以上的表設(shè)計(jì),可以非常方便地實(shí)現(xiàn)產(chǎn)品分類的管理和呈現(xiàn)。在實(shí)際開發(fā)過程中,還可以根據(jù)業(yè)務(wù)需求對該表進(jìn)行調(diào)整和優(yōu)化。
上一篇自動彈出層css